About Social and political science
Learn how the current challenges faced in Australia and internationally by political, legal and social institutions should respond to complex problems generated in an era of globalisation and rapid social change.
Study the disciplines of criminology, development studies, international studies, political science, public and social policy, socio-legal studies, anthropology and sociology.
Career outcomes include local, state and federal government, non-governmental organisations, the media, education, justice, and further academic research.
